Android(Java)日期和时间处理完全解析——使用 Gson 和 Joda-Time 优雅地处理日常开发中关于时间处理的问题 – Android – 掘金
原创声明: 该文章为原创文章,未经博主同意严禁转载。 简介:对于Android和Java开发者来说,时间的处理是我们必须掌握的知识。如果你尝试过造时间处理方面的轮子的话,你就会知道,关于时间的处理是一个非常复杂的问题。我们在处…
『Material Design入门学习笔记』TabLayout与NestedScrollView(附demo) – 掘金
不知不觉,这已经是『Material Design入门学习笔记』专题第六篇文章了,结束了这篇文章,这个专题,会暂时告一段落。但不是结束,也许仅仅是另一个开始。『Material Design入门学习笔记』前言『Material Design入门学习笔记』动画(…
Android Theme.AppCompat 中,你应该熟悉的颜色属性 – 掘金
创建一个 Android 工程,第一步,也是必不可少的一步,就是定制 Application 主题样式。利用系统诸多属性定义 App 各种 View 的默认样式,能够减少 layout 文件中很多重复性的属性设置代码。在开发者官网 R.attr 栏目中,Goo…
Android 中你不得不知的几个问题及解决方法 – Android – 掘金
转载请注明出处:From李诗雨—http://blog.csdn.net/cjm24848… 不诗意的女程序猿不是好厨师~ 这个周末整理了一下几个十分常用的问题及解决方法。文章很零散,于是就又写了这…
原来我之前并不懂:Android 之 Spanned flag – Android – 掘金
年前的这几天,一直在看代码,发现自己之前对很多技术点的理解都不全面,甚至根本就是想当然。所以有这样一个想法,要把之前理解很粗浅的东西慢慢整理一遍,补一下技术上的短板。 这个过程会比较长,准备把涉及到的不同技术点写一个系列…
Android 必知必会 – 根据包名判断 App 运行状态 – 掘金
获取指定包名的 APP 是否还在后台运行,判断 APP 是否存活。 背景 可以根据 App 是否有 Service 分两类情况处理: 没有 Service 有 Service 对于没有 Service 的 App,程序一旦切换到后台,可能很快就被回收了,这…
从源码角度分析 NestedScrolling – Android – 掘金
通过CoordinatorLayout可以实现许多炫酷的效果,大家可以参考我之前一篇博客: 一起玩转CoordinatorLayout 其实Coo…
Android 新特性介绍,ConstraintLayout 完全解析 – Android – 掘金
转载请注明出处:http://blog.csdn.net/guolin_b… 今天给大家带来2017年的第一篇文章,这里先祝大家新年好。 …
Android工程gradle详解 – 掘金
版本的统一管理 当我们的工程中有许多module的时候,分开管理编译版本,minsdk将会是一件很麻烦的事,因为一个library的改动,可能会影响到其他module。这时我们就需要对所有的版本进行统一的管理,管理的方式有两种: rootProject 我们可…
Groovy 基础知识 – Android – 掘金
在学习gralde的时候,经常会有一些语法不知如何操作,这时候就需要一些groovy的基础知识了。 基本语法 Groovy注释标记和Java一样,支持//或者/**/Groovy语句可以不用分号结…
Android 中实现滑动的七种方式 – Android – 掘金
在Android中想要实现实现滑动有很多方法,这篇博客将提供一些实现滑动的思路,希望可以帮助到有需要的人。 一、Android坐标体系 …
安卓 5.0 6.0 新特性简单总结 – Android – 掘金
Android 5.0新特性 1. 了解Material Design …
Android 状态栏操作,你想知道的都在这里了 – 掘金
一直以来,iOS 设备上状态栏背景色和图标文字颜色的灵活可变性始终受到设计人员的青睐,有意地恰当地融入到 App 的各种界面设计当中,更好地提升用户体验。 由于系统的限制,在老版本的安卓系统中,Android App 无法做到这些,产生一些设计上的遗憾。幸运的…
android 界面 UI 美化:沉浸模式、全透明或半透明状态栏及导航栏的实现 – Android – 掘金
Android api19开始我们就能对顶部状态栏和底部导航栏进行半透明处理了,而api21开始则可以实现全透明状态栏与导航栏以及开启沉浸模式,至于什么是沉浸模式,大家百度一下应该就都知道了,有一点需要强调的是全透明不是沉浸模式,前者只是将状态栏、导航栏的背景…
Android 富文本类库,支持图文混排 – Android – 掘金
一个Android富文本类库,支持图文混排,支持编辑和预览,支持插入和删除图片。 实现的原理: …
Android 获得状态栏、标题栏以及控件的高度 – Android – 掘金
注意,数据的获取应该在onWindowFocusChanged函数中进行,防止数据获取错误。 首先声明整个手机屏幕的获取: activity.getWindowManager().getDefaultDisplay(); …
Android 存储路径你了解多少 – Android – 掘金
在了解存储路径之前,先来看看Android QQ的文件管理界面,了解一下QQ的数据文件路径来源,到底是来源于什么地方? 手Q文件管理对应存储目录 …
Android 沉浸式状态栏必知必会 – Android – 掘金
Android状态栏默认是固定的黑底白字,这肯定是不被伟大的设计师所喜爱的,更有甚者,某些时候设计希望内容能够延时到状态栏底部(例如头部是大图的情况)。所幸的是随着Android版本的迭代,开发者对状态栏等控件有了更多的控制。Android一直在尝试引入新的A…
Material Design 学习资料收集 – Android – 掘金
本人目前正在找工作,想了解我的详细情况请移步到我的 网页版简历 ,希望能得到各位的推荐,谢谢! 关于 Material Design 在这里我就不…
Android | Activity和Fragment最全生命周期+发现大牛 – 掘金
— 作者 谢恩铭 转载请注明出处 今天给大家介绍的不但是一个Github上的不错项目, 详细图解和实验了Android的Activity和Fragment的生命周期的各个方面, 相当不错! 还顺便介绍一位超厉害的大牛! Github地址 这个项目是开源在…
[[Android 从头再来] App 启动过程 – Android – 掘金](https://juejin.im/entry/58d0f…
App启动方式 如何启动App呢?说到底就是点击屏幕的App图标。但是点击的时候会发现有时进入App首页很快,有时很慢,有时中间还有个白屏。有时中间还有个黑屏。造成这样的情况,是什么原因呢?我们先从App启动的方式开始说起。 冷…